The strong western winds last weekend caused a rapid rise of the seawater level and by Saturday morning the sea already splashed only a few centimetres from our camera, on Sunday there was already deep choppy sea.

Before moving it the doings of waders could be observed directly at the camera and it was a good opportunity to identify bird species. Determining waders is otherwise a tricky enterprise even for experienced birdwatchers because of their similarity.

New camera. In the centre of the image there is a salt lick, which is why the animals visit the place at all. As autumn proceeds we expect ever more deer in camera view since in the later half of autumn the winter flocks start to gather. The site on the border between field and forest verge is a favourite place for roe deer.

The peak period of the waders’ migration is approaching. We have installed the camera in western Estonia, on the Noarootsi coast to observe the migration of waders; the site is considered to be the best in Läänemaa for studying and observing the waders’ migration.

Three days of straying around for the young black stork … A miracle that it could find the nest. Anyway, the only one of the clutch who has gathered experiences of taking flight, flying, landing, getting its bearings and who knows what more in addition.
